The number of men studying for the priesthood for the Diocese of Charlotte has tripled in the past seven years, creating a greater need for funding to support our 49 seminarians. The Seminarian Education Fund is the primary way we can support seminarians and foster vocations to help meet the growing need for priests to serve in our diocese. Currently, 21 men are enrolled at St. Joseph College Seminary in Mount Holly and 28 men are enrolled in major seminary at Mount St. Mary’s Seminary.

This is a friendly reminder that your student(s) are required to have new health information on file. These are required by NC state law and the dates for physicals must be within a year of the first day of school (August 16, 2023). Letters were sent home in students’ folders who did not have the required information on file but if you are unsure if your student is up to date, please contact the health room.

“To Serve is to Love” is the theme of the 2023 Diocesan Support Appeal. We are called to follow Christ’s example to serve one another with love and compassion. Your contribution to the DSA helps fund the social service, educational, multicultural and vocational ministries of the diocese. When we make our annual contribution to the Diocesan Support Appeal, we join with all our brothers and sisters in Christ throughout the diocese to do the Lord’s work, works of love and service that no one individual or parish can do alone. Thousands of people across the diocese benefit because of the DSA-funded ministries. Among those served are: 42,070 Children and Adults enrolled in Faith Formation Programs 6,896 Students in Catholic Schools 1,250 Teenagers through Youth Ministry programs 1,760 Catholic college students through Campus Ministry programs at 21 colleges/universities 18,762 Clients of Catholic Charities Diocese of Charlotte, with regional offices in Asheville, Charlotte and Winston-Salem 136 Permanent deacons through the Permanent Diaconate program 49 Seminarians currently discerning or in formation for the diocese

The Diocese of Charlotte celebrates its golden anniversary in 2022 – a year to be hallmarked by a renewal of our Catholic faith. Celebrations include a diocese-wide Marian Pilgrimage, the 2022 Eucharistic Congress, family-friendly events, 50 Acts of Charity, and historical highlights of the Church in western North Carolina from missionary times to today’s diverse and growing diocese.
Throughout this anniversary year, let us recall the past with gratitude, celebrate the present with joy, and look to the future with hope that we might glorify God and strengthen our diocesan family – above all, affirming our faith which is “more precious than gold.”
Help protect all of God’s children Everyone has a role to play in protecting children. North Carolina law requires all adults to immediately report suspected child abuse by anyone to law enforcement agencies. If you know or suspect that a minor (person under 18) has been abused, please call 9-1-1 or contact local law enforcement. Also, if you have information about possible sexual abuse or misconduct by any clergy, employee or volunteer of the Diocese of Charlotte, report concerns securely and anonymously 24/7 over the phone or online: 1-888-630-5929 or www.RedFlagReporting.com/RCDOC. Safe Environment training Did you know that every Church worker must go through abuse prevention and education training? Boys State 2023
Congratulations to Saint Pius X alumni, Gus Mentina who will be representing Bishop at the Tar Heels Boys State Conference June 18-24, 2023 at Catawba College. Gus will be attending with two other Bishop students, Keenan Griffey and Tyler Pesavento.
Tar Heel Boys' State is a leadership program of ACTION where participants learn today to lead tomorrow. The program is highly intense in nature and teaches in a practical way the principles of good government at the city, county and state levels. The program will offer the outstanding young men of North Carolina who are to become citizens of Boys' State a wonderful and challenging experience.
